Wow. Where do I start. Firstly let’s talk about what you are expecting from your stay. For us, it was purely a business trip. We were using this place as somewhere to get our head down as we were going to be out most of the day. Location: the location of this hotel is awful. There is nothing around. The food they were offering on the menu was so little we decided to go out and find a restaurant. That was impossible! We were walking for 45 minutes (with no Road but I will get to that in a minute) only to find a time town with few cafes and pharmacy. No food anywhere. Now, to get to this town was the scariest walk of my life. There are no pavements. We had to walk on busy roads around bends and everytime I heard a car come, I just tensed up, expecting to be knocked over. The Pool: it was green, dirty and very very small. The food: after our 1.5 hour round trek we decided to come back to the hotel to get food, we were starving. We had been travelling all day. I settled for a vegetarian pizza, would have been nice if it was cooked, it was cold in the middle and hot on the edges. Whatever my husband wanted wasn’t available (burger, pie, meat pizza) so he settled for duck rice. Omg this was the most awful thing I’ve ever seen. The rice was microwave packet rice and the duck…. Well, check out my pictures and judge for yourself. The staff: I have to say, the staff were lovely. Friendly and eager to help. Drinks: there were probably, a choice of 4/5 drinks to choose from. Great if you like whiskey or gin. The room: the room was small, basic and mostly clean. Just very dated and very old. Overall: I know this is a 2 start hotel, so my expectations really weren’t very high but I at least expected it to be in a location where we could walk to get a drink / food somewhere.
